14 Bible Verses about Curiosity
Most Relevant Verses
The great multitude of the Jews therefore knew that he was there; and they came, not only on account of Jesus, but that they might see Lazarus also, whom he raised from the dead.
Now all the Athenians, and the strangers residing among them, spent their leisure for nothing else but to tell or to hear something new.
Then some of the scribes and Pharisees answered him, saying, Teacher, we wish to see a sign from thee.
And the Pharisees and Sadducees came to try him, and asked him to show them a sign from heaven.
And as he was sitting upon the Mount of Olives, the disciples came to him privately, saying, Tell us, when will these things be? and what will be the signs of thy coming, and of the end of the world?
And the Pharisees came out, and began to question with him, seeking of him a sign from heaven, trying him.
The Jews therefore answered and said to him, What sign dost thou show us, seeing thou doest these things?
Then Jesus said to him, Unless ye see signs and wonders, ye will not believe.
They said therefore to him, What sign doest thou, that we may see, and believe thee? What dost thou work?
And a great multitude followed him, because they saw the signs which he wrought on the diseased.
to whom it was revealed, that not to themselves, but to you, they were ministering the things, which have now been announced to you by them that have brought the glad tidings to you by the Holy Spirit sent down from heaven; which things angels desire to look into.
But he said to them, It belongeth not to you to know times or seasons, which the Father appointed by his own authority.
